Does Gregory River or North Gregory have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), North Gregory scores 947 vs 943 in Gregory River.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.

Which is more walkable, Gregory River or North Gregory?

Gregory River scores 2/100 on walkability vs 0/100. Above 70 is considered very walkable (most errands on foot), 50-69 is walkable for some errands, below 50 typically requires a car for daily life.
